ISO 8502-3 describes a method for assessing the quantity and size of dust particles on blast-cleaned steel surfaces. The procedure uses a specific type of pressure-sensitive adhesive tape to lift dust from the surface. This tape is then applied to a white or black display board to be evaluated visually against a comparator chart.
